Output f70e9626b14b0a66052c7dda7639d5279ece3c67d85006aed0c59b915406aa1a:0

value
9327156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f332a6c305b38a1c7ad47daabff7794c231d238 OP_EQUAL
address
3EkBr2nXKpijpA2tDpiApXg6BeLyUgMrDr
transaction
f70e9626b14b0a66052c7dda7639d5279ece3c67d85006aed0c59b915406aa1a
spent
true